Transaction 45622ebacdbaca90d498054e9e45fe24f5bcd9c69ffdc742b21e1625709fbd09
1 Input
1 Output
-
45622ebacdbaca90d498054e9e45fe24f5bcd9c69ffdc742b21e1625709fbd09:0
- value
- 123037
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 15310adbcac669425c92bab3fbfdc1e51aed0477 OP_EQUAL
- address
- 33d4s6hLAZfJ5F1JHEst2C4awsF8C26Sbq